Are you going to prepare food with fresh basil? Try putting a bunch of basil that is fresh inside a glass. Next, ensure the stems are covered with water. Set the glass on the kitchen counter or windowsill to maintain its freshness for weeks. Frequent changes of the water might even encourage the basil to spread out some roots. If this happens, trim the basil once in a while. This promotes continued growth, which means you have fresh basil at your disposal well into the future. When using fresh herbs like parsley or dill, gather them into bunches and cut them with scissors. Chopping herbs often makes herbs wet and wilted.
